Roofing in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a property's roof to identify existing issues and potential vulnerabilities. Trained professionals examine the roof's surface, checking for signs of damage, deterioration, or wear such as missing shingles, cracks, or water stains. They also evaluate the condition of flashing, gutters, and ventilation systems to ensure all components are functioning properly. This process helps property owners understand the current state of their roofs and determine whether repairs or maintenance are necessary to prevent future problems.

Inspection Costs - Typical costs for a roofing inspection range from $150 to $400,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more complex roofs may cost more, sometimes exceeding $500.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ific property needs.
Service Fees - Service fees for roofing inspections generally fall between $100 and $300. These fees may vary based on the inspector’s experience and the scope of the inspection required. Some providers include a basic assessment within this range.
Additional Charges - Additional costs might include detailed reports or specialized inspections, which can add $50 to $200 to the overall price. Extra services are often billed separately and depend on the property's condition and inspection depth.
Cost Factors - Factors influencing costs include roof size, height, and accessibility, with prices varying accordingly. Complex or hard-to-reach roofs tend to increase the overall inspection expense. Local service providers can offer tailored cost estimates for specific properties.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a roofing inspection service? A roofing inspection service involves a professional evaluating the condition of a roof to identify potential issues, damage, or areas needing maintenance.
Why should I schedule a roofing inspection? Regular inspections can help detect problems early, potentially preventing costly repairs and extending the lifespan of a roof.
How often should a roof be inspected? It is recommended to have a roof inspected at least once a year and after severe weather events to ensure its integrity.
What issues can a roofing inspection reveal? Inspections can uncover issues such as leaks, damaged shingles, flashing problems, or signs of wear and tear that may require repairs.
